About 2-[1-(5-chloro-2-methoxyphenyl)-5-methylpyrazol-4-yl]-5-(4-fluorophenyl)-1,3,4-oxadiazole
2-[1-(5-chloro-2-methoxyphenyl)-5-methylpyrazol-4-yl]-5-(4-fluorophenyl)-1,3,4-oxadiazole (PubChem CID 44513646) has the molecular formula C19H14ClFN4O2
and a molecular weight of 384.80 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is 2-[1-(5-chloro-2-methoxyphenyl)-5-methylpyrazol-4-yl]-5-(4-fluorophenyl)-1,3,4-oxadiazole.

What is the SMILES notation for 2-[1-(5-chloro-2-methoxyphenyl)-5-methylpyrazol-4-yl]-5-(4-fluorophenyl)-1,3,4-oxadiazole?
The canonical SMILES for 2-[1-(5-chloro-2-methoxyphenyl)-5-methylpyrazol-4-yl]-5-(4-fluorophenyl)-1,3,4-oxadiazole is COc1ccc(Cl)cc1-n1ncc(-c2nnc(-c3ccc(F)cc3)o2)c1C.
What is the InChIKey of 2-[1-(5-chloro-2-methoxyphenyl)-5-methylpyrazol-4-yl]-5-(4-fluorophenyl)-1,3,4-oxadiazole?
The InChIKey is DCEGAIJQMQYOCV-UHFFFAOYSA-N. The full InChI is InChI=1S/C19H14ClFN4O2/c1-11-15(10-22-25(11)16-9-13(20)5-8-17(16)26-2)19-24-23-18(27-19)12-3-6-14(21)7-4-12/h3-10H,1-2H3.
What are the key properties of 2-[1-(5-chloro-2-methoxyphenyl)-5-methylpyrazol-4-yl]-5-(4-fluorophenyl)-1,3,4-oxadiazole?
2-[1-(5-chloro-2-methoxyphenyl)-5-methylpyrazol-4-yl]-5-(4-fluorophenyl)-1,3,4-oxadiazole has a molecular weight of 384.80 g/mol, XLogP of 4.70, 4 rotatable bonds, 0 hydrogen bond donors, and 6 hydrogen bond acceptors.
